Employer Case study - Cedar Mews Care Home

“I was delighted to be asked if I would like to work with the Supported Employment Team at Leicester City Council, to recruit people into work who have Autism and/or Learning Disabilities for Cedar Mews Care Home.  We have employed two staff members, and they have shown commitment and dedication to the company becoming trusted team members.

The support I have received has been excellent throughout the process and continues with regular calls to see if any further help is needed.  I was supported through the interview process with each candidate having a job coach and thoroughly enjoyed my morning of interviewing and meeting new people.

The team arranged meetings throughout the recruitment process ensuring we had all information and working with the candidate to make this was as smooth as possible.

Each employee has a job coach which has been available for us to contact should we need any help and when I have asked for further support with training our staff, they have provided face to face sessions.

I would not hesitate to go through this process again should we have any further suitable vacancies.”

Joanne Hughes, Cedar Mews care home
